Background of the Study :
The Internet of Things (IoT) is transforming various sectors by enabling seamless connectivity and automation. In higher education, IoT adoption in university hostels can improve resource management, enhance security, and streamline daily operations. This study aims to analyze the adoption and impact of IoT technologies in university hostels at the Federal University of Technology, Minna, Niger State. The research will examine how IoT devices, such as smart locks, energy management systems, and occupancy sensors, are integrated into hostel infrastructure to improve operational efficiency and resident safety. By collecting and analyzing data on usage patterns, system performance, and user satisfaction, the study will provide insights into the benefits and challenges associated with IoT implementation in an academic setting (Ibrahim, 2023). The analysis will involve both qualitative and quantitative methodologies, including surveys, interviews, and data analytics. Furthermore, the study will assess the cost-effectiveness of IoT solutions and their potential to reduce operational expenses. Emphasis will be placed on the scalability and sustainability of these technologies, particularly in the context of Nigerian higher education institutions. The findings are expected to inform policy decisions and encourage wider adoption of IoT in university hostels, ultimately enhancing the living conditions and overall experience of students (Olu, 2024; Adeniran, 2025).
Statement of the Problem :
Despite the potential benefits of IoT, its adoption in university hostels in Nigeria is still in its infancy. Many institutions continue to rely on traditional management systems that are inefficient and prone to errors. At the Federal University of Technology, Minna, there is limited data on how IoT devices impact hostel management and resident satisfaction. The absence of standardized protocols and the high initial cost of IoT solutions further deter adoption. Additionally, challenges such as data security, system interoperability, and maintenance issues can impede the successful integration of IoT technologies in hostel settings. This study seeks to address these challenges by evaluating the current state of IoT adoption in university hostels, identifying the key factors that influence its effectiveness, and proposing strategies to overcome existing barriers. By understanding the advantages and limitations of IoT in this context, the research aims to provide actionable recommendations for enhancing hostel management, improving energy efficiency, and ensuring the safety of residents. The outcomes of this study are expected to facilitate the broader adoption of IoT solutions in academic institutions across Nigeria, leading to improved operational efficiency and a better quality of life for students (Ibrahim, 2023; Olu, 2024).
